Evolving Images: Jewish Latin American Cinema
ISBN: 9781477314265 / Angielski / Twarda / 2018 / 264 str. Termin realizacji zamówienia: ok. 30 dni roboczych. With critical essays by leading scholars from Latin America, the United States, Europe, and Israel, this is the first volume devoted to Jewish filmmaking and films with Jewish themes and characters in Latin America.

The Surviving Image: Phantoms of Time and Time of Phantoms: Aby Warburg's History of Art
ISBN: 9780271072081 / Angielski / Twarda / 2016 / 432 str. Termin realizacji zamówienia: ok. 30 dni roboczych. The Surviving Image, originally published in French in 2002, is the result of Georges Didi-Huberman's extensive research into the life and work of foundational art historian Aby Warburg. Warburg envisioned an art history that drew from anthropology, psychoanalysis, and philosophy in order to understand the "life" of images. Escape from the Market: Negotiating Work in Lancashire
ISBN: 9780521561518 / Angielski / Twarda / 1996 / 242 str. Termin realizacji zamówienia: ok. 16-18 dni roboczych. This book questions the conventional wisdom that in the heyday of laisez-faire capitalism wages were set by thorough going competition. Drawing on the experience of a key group of workers during industrialization, this book shows that even in the absence of trade unions, minimum wage legislation or unemployment insurance, wages do not always move with changes in the demand for and supply of labor. Workers and firms have good reasons to fix wages independently of market fluctuations.

Intro to Socialism
ISBN: 9780853450672 / Angielski / Miękka / 1968 / 132 str. Termin realizacji zamówienia: ok. 16-18 dni roboczych. This introduction to socialist thought is by two men perhaps better qualified than any other Americans to have written it. Leo Huberman and Paul Sweezy, founding editors and publishers of the independent socialist magazine Monthly Review, built an impressive reputation as keen observers, acute analysts, and lucid writers on the world and domestic scenes. In this book, they present in clear and direct language the basic elements of the socialist critique of capitalist society.

Invention of Hysteria: Charcot and the Photographic Iconography of the Salpetriere
ISBN: 9780262541800 / Angielski / Miękka / 2004 / 392 str. Termin realizacji zamówienia: ok. 16-18 dni roboczych. In this classic of French cultural studies, Georges Didi-Huberman traces the intimate and reciprocal relationship between the disciplines of psychiatry and photography in the late nineteenth century. Focusing on the immense photographic output of the Salpetriere hospital, the notorious Parisian asylum for insane and incurable women, Didi-Huberman shows the crucial role played by photography in the invention of the category of hysteria.
